by JK Racing
call-911 wrote:It wouldn't be so bad if you cut parts of the windows out or a section of the bed.
Problem is, that body has poor support in the center (cab) section....if you were to cut windows or bed parts out, it would be even worse.

An undertray the width of the body MAY help some, but there is still the parachute effect in the wheel openings.

Other problem with this truck body is no rear downforce, I had a huge buggy wing on the rear of the body...didnt help much.
